CVE-2016-5025 in Graphics Driverinfo

Summary

by MITRE

For the NVIDIA Quadro, NVS, GeForce products, improper sanitization of parameters in the NVAPI support layer causes a denial of service vulnerability (blue screen crash) within the NVIDIA Windows graphics drivers.

If you want to get the best quality for vulnerability data then you always have to consider VulDB.

Analysis

by VulDB Data Team • 05/27/2019

The vulnerability identified as CVE-2016-5025 represents a critical flaw in NVIDIA's graphics driver architecture affecting Quadro, NVS, and GeForce product lines. This issue resides within the NVAPI support layer, which serves as a crucial interface between applications and the graphics hardware. The improper sanitization of parameters creates a condition where malformed input can trigger system instability, resulting in complete system crashes manifesting as blue screen errors. The vulnerability specifically impacts Windows operating systems and demonstrates the dangerous consequences of inadequate input validation in kernel-level components.

The technical root cause of this vulnerability stems from insufficient parameter validation within the NVAPI subsystem that handles graphics driver interactions. When applications pass malformed or unexpected parameters to the graphics driver through NVAPI interfaces, the system fails to properly sanitize these inputs before processing them. This lack of proper input validation creates a path for malicious or malformed data to reach critical driver components, ultimately leading to memory corruption and system crashes. The flaw operates at the kernel level where graphics drivers execute with elevated privileges, making the potential impact significantly more severe than typical user-space vulnerabilities. This vulnerability directly maps to CWE-129, which addresses insufficient validation of length of input buffers, and CWE-131, which covers incorrect calculation of buffer size.

The operational impact of CVE-2016-5025 extends beyond simple system instability to represent a serious denial of service threat that can affect enterprise environments and consumer systems alike. Organizations relying on NVIDIA graphics hardware for critical operations face potential downtime risks, while individual users may experience unexpected system crashes during gaming sessions or professional graphics work. The vulnerability can be exploited through various attack vectors including malicious software, compromised applications, or even legitimate software that inadvertently passes malformed parameters to the graphics driver. The blue screen crashes caused by this vulnerability can result in data loss, system instability, and productivity interruptions that are particularly problematic in professional environments where graphics performance is critical for workflows involving CAD, video editing, or scientific visualization.

Mitigation strategies for CVE-2016-5025 primarily focus on immediate driver updates from NVIDIA, which address the parameter sanitization issues within the NVAPI support layer. System administrators should prioritize deployment of the latest NVIDIA graphics drivers that contain patches for this vulnerability, as these updates implement proper input validation mechanisms. Additionally, organizations should consider implementing application whitelisting policies to control which applications can interact with graphics driver interfaces, reducing the attack surface for exploitation. Network segmentation and monitoring solutions can help detect anomalous behavior patterns that might indicate exploitation attempts. The vulnerability highlights the importance of maintaining current driver versions and implementing robust input validation practices in all kernel-level components. Security professionals should also consider monitoring for blue screen events and system crashes as potential indicators of exploitation attempts. This vulnerability demonstrates the critical need for comprehensive security testing of driver components and proper parameter validation in system-level software, aligning with ATT&CK technique T1068 which covers exploit for privilege escalation and T1489 which addresses denial of service through system resource consumption.

Reservation

05/24/2016

Disclosure

11/08/2016

Moderation

accepted

Entry

VDB-93335

CPE

ready

EPSS

0.00065

KEV

no

Activities

very low

Sources

Do you need the next level of professionalism?

Upgrade your account now!